>>>> dp_display caches the current display mode and then passes it onto
>>>> the panel to be used for programming the panel params. Remove this
>>>> two level passing and directly populated the panel's dp_display_mode
>>>> instead.
>>>
>>> - Why do we need to cache / copy it anyway? Can't we just pass the
>>>     corresponding drm_atomic_state / drm_crtc_state / drm_display_mode ?
>>>
>> This part works as follows: .mode_set() copies the adjusted_mode into
>> msm_dp_display_private->msm_dp_display_mode, and also parses and stores
>> variables such as v_active_low/h_active_low/out_fmt_is_yuv_420 and ... When
>> @drm_bridge_funcs.atomic_enable() is called, it copies
>> msm_dp_display->msm_dp_mode into dp_panel->msm_dp_mode and initializes
>> panel_info in msm_dp_display_set_mode(). Then when go to
>> msm_dp_ctrl_on_stream(), the parameters are updated into the corresponding
>> hardware registers.
> 
> So, if we do everything during .atomic_enable(), there would be no need
> to store and/or copy anything. All the data is available and can be used
> as is.

>> Originally, the drm_mode would be passed in
>> two stages: from msm_dp_display->msm_dp_mode to dp_panel->msm_dp_mode. Since
>> in MST mode each stream requires its own drm_mode and stored in dp_panel, we
>> simplified the two-stage transfer into a single step (.mode_set() do all
>> things and store in msm_dp_panel). Meanwhile we modified the
>> msm_dp_display_set_mode function to accept a msm_dp_panel parameter,
>> allowing the MST bridge funcs' mode_set() to reuse this part code.
>>
>> The following patches:
>> https://patchwork.freedesktop.org/patch/657573/?series=142207&rev=2 and
>> https://patchwork.freedesktop.org/patch/657593/?series=142207&rev=2,
>> introduce msm_dp_display_*_helper functions to help reuse common code across
>> MST/SST/eDP drm_bridge_funcs.
>>
>> If we drop msm_dp_mode from dp_panel and use drm_display_mode, it might
>> introduce a large number of changes that are not directly related to MST.
>> Actually i think the presence of msm_dp_display_mode seems to simplify the
>> work in msm_dp_panel_timing_cfg(), this patch series we want to focus on MST
>> parts, so would we consider optimizing them later?
> 
> Sure... But then you have to change two places. If you optimize it
> first, you have to touch only place. And it can be even submitted
> separately.
